The second in a series of locally written plays. "The Ladder" is based on an actual incident which the author witnessed. In the play Mark Berriman focuses on the exchanges between two university professors and a sign writer. Perched atop a ladder, the sign writer observes and becomes involved with two academics on the ground - indulging in shaky logic and showy verbal acrobatics. There is an ironic contrast between the two academics, proud not to be "practitioners" and the man who at least paints a sign. |
